Social organization of cooperatively breeding long‐tailed tits: kinship and spatial dynamics

Hatchwell, B. J. ; Anderson, C. ; Ross, D. J. ; Fowlie, M. K. ; Blackwell, P. G.



Abstract

1. Long-tailed tits Aegithalos caudatus L. are cooperative breeders in which breeders that have failed in their own breeding attempt become helpers at the nest of relatives.
